In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

ASoC: mediatek: mt8183: Release reserved memory on cleanup

The MT8183 AFE probe can assign reserved memory with
of_reserved_mem_device_init(), but the assignment is never released on
driver removal or later probe failures.

Register a devm cleanup action so the reserved memory assignment is
released consistently, matching newer Mediatek AFE drivers.
